2010/2011
The Executive Bureau (or, simply, “Bureau”) is the EDS organ responsible for running the organisation on a day-to-day basis, drawing policy and representing EDS to the outside world.
The Bureau reports directly to the Council which is the highest governing body of EDS consisted of representatives from all 35 full member organisations. The period in office (tenure) of the Bureau lasts for one working year and current Bureau was elected at the Annual Meeting in July 2010 in Slovakia. The Bureau consists of voting and non-voting members. As they are directly elected by the Council, EDS Chairman and eight Vice-chairmen are voting members of the Bureau while Honorary Chairman, Secretary General and Area Directors, as appointed members, have no voting rights.
